Garner played in four games off the bench during his 2014 redshirt freshman and 2015 sophomore seasons over his four campaign at Cal from 2013-16 and totaled five tackles all as a redshirt freshman after he redshirted in his first campaign at Cal as a true freshman in 2013. His father, Dwight Garner, was a four-year letterwinner at Cal from 1982-85 and made one of the five laterals during “The Play” as a freshman, while also leading the team in punt returns as a 1983 sophomore, receiving as a 1984 junior, and kick returns as both a sophomore and junior.

University School (Class of 2013)/North Broward Prep (2009-10)
• Played his final two seasons as a junior and senior in 2011 and 2012 at University School with his squad combining for a 25-1 overall record and an 11-0 3A District 8 mark
• Had 35 tackles, one interception that he returned 15 yards and two passes defended during his senior campaign on a squad that won the Florida 3A state title and finished with a 13-0 overall record and a 3-0 3A District 8 mark, while picking up the state’s No. 3 ranking, a No. 10 Xcellent 25 ranking and a No. 24 national ranking according to MaxPreps
• Contributed 24 tackles, one fumble recovery and two passes defended as a junior when his squad was 11-1 overall and 8-0 in 3A District 8 competition
• Also ran the 300 meter hurdles, while participating on the University School’s basketball team
• Earned his school’s Character Award in 2013
• Spent his first two prep campaigns at North Broward Prep during the 2009 and 2010 football seasons
• A member of the National Honor Society

Other
• Full name is David James Garner
• Born August 26, 1994
• Parents are Dwight and Vida Garner
• Father was a four-year letterwinner at Cal from 1982-85 who made one of the five laterals during “The Play” as a freshman, while also leading the team in punt returns as a 1983 sophomore, receiving as a 1984 junior, and kick returns both as a sophomore and junior before eventually joining the Washington Redskins for one season in 1986 after signing an undrafted free agent contract
• Graduated from Cal in May of 2017 with a bachelor’s degree in legal studies
